KTEC tracks the Hang Seng TECH Index, providing targeted exposure to the 30 largest technology companies listed on the Hong Kong Stock Exchange. It focuses on innovative, internet-based businesses across sectors like e-commerce, fintech, cloud computing, and digital technology.

The company designs and fabricates superconducting quantum processors and integrates them with a full-stack software and control platform. Rigetti offers access to its quantum computers through the cloud, aiming to solve complex computational problems that are intractable for classical computers, with applications in finance, chemistry, and machine learning.
